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0761503 2595029808 423886058
89293339703 520557
89293339703 520557
82859 662332073 59982
All about undefined
Interested in learning more?
89293339703 520557
82859 662332073 59982
See more
72386973543 1508
5589 76 070 865
See more
57053 5990236318 0637067982
980986 06613 07175616684 03561340308
See more